Elevate satellite technology development as a Senior Test Software Developer at MDA Space. Use your Python and C++ expertise in a collaborative Windows environment focused on satellite payload testing.
At MDA Space, you will be pivotal in creating top-quality software for satellite payload testing. This senior role requires a strong understanding of complex specifications and existing frameworks while contributing to agile team dynamics. Your experience will drive efficient project planning and software deployment efforts.
Key Responsibilities:
• Design and code software applications for satellite payload tests
• Plan and estimate effort for timely project delivery
• Debug and document software applications thoroughly
• Engage in integration and deployment activities
• Collaborate in an agile team to implement best practices
Requirements:
• University degree in Software Engineering or related field
• Over 5 years of test software development experience
• Proficiency in Python and C++, including APIs
• Experience with agile development methodologies
• Strong communication skills in English and French
